- Low-latency mic claim addresses the lag that ruins timing
- Mic priority auto-ducks tracks when someone speaks or sings
- Karaoke mode helps reduce original vocals for sing-alongs
- Alloy woofer messaging targets clearer adult vocals
- Shoulder strap and multi-input flexibility suit BBQ mobility
- Party lights and high volume still drain batteries faster
- True studio monitoring it is not—expect fun PA energy
- TWS stereo needs a second speaker purchase
